- Como faço para consertar novamente o reinicialização do contêiner com falha?
- O que causa a volta de reiniciar o contêiner falhado?
- O que está de volta reiniciando o contêiner fracassado AWS?
- O que é erro de retirada em Kubernetes?
- Como faço para forçar um recipiente a reiniciar?
- Pode falhar no disco rígido causar reinicializações?
- Qual é o motivo mais comum para um pod de denunciar o CrashLoopbackoff como seu estado?
- Qual é o motivo da falha do pod?
- Como faço para impedir que um recipiente do documento seja reiniciado?
- Reiniciando um contêiner perde dados?
- O que é reversão na AWS?
- O que reinicia um contêiner faz?
- Como faço para impedir que um recipiente do documento seja reiniciado?
- Como faço para mudar a política de reinicialização do contêiner?
- Como alterar a política de reinicialização do contêiner do Docker?
- O que é a política de reinicialização do contêiner sobre o fracasso?
- Reiniciando o Docker reiniciar todos os recipientes?
Como faço para consertar novamente o reinicialização do contêiner com falha?
Recupere de volta o reinicialização do contêiner com falha
Se você receber a mensagem de reinicialização do reinicialização do back-off, isso significa que você está lidando com uma sobrecarga temporária de recursos, como resultado de um pico de atividade. A solução é ajustar os segundos de períodos ou timeoutSegunds para dar ao aplicativo uma janela mais longa para responder.
O que causa a volta de reiniciar o contêiner falhado?
1. Verifique se há Kubectl de “Back off Off Reiniciando o contêiner . Se você obtiver uma sonda de lactive falhou e reiniciando as mensagens de contêiner com falha do Kubelet, como mostrado abaixo, isso indica que o contêiner não está respondendo e está em processo de reinicialização.
O que está de volta reiniciando o contêiner fracassado AWS?
Se você receber a mensagem de saída "reinicialização do reinicialização", então seu contêiner provavelmente saiu em breve depois que Kubernetes iniciou o contêiner. Se a investigação de lactive não estiver retornando um status bem -sucedido, verifique se a sonda de lactive está configurada corretamente para o aplicativo.
O que é erro de retirada em Kubernetes?
CrashLoopbackoff é um estado de Kubernetes que representa um loop de reinicialização que está acontecendo em uma vagem: um recipiente no pod é iniciado, mas falha e é reiniciado, repetidamente. Kubernetes esperará um tempo de retomfada crescente entre os reinicializações para lhe dar a chance de corrigir o erro.
Como faço para forçar um recipiente a reiniciar?
Se você deseja reiniciar seu contêiner que já está parado, você pode usar o comando Start Docker para reiniciar o contêiner. Assim como o usamos quando criamos nosso contêiner. Existe um comando de reinicialização do Docker que pode ser usado para reiniciar o contêiner que já está sendo executado em segundo plano.
Pode falhar no disco rígido causar reinicializações?
Reinicializações repentinas são um sinal de uma possível falha no disco rígido. Como é a tela azul da morte, quando a tela do computador fica azul, congela e pode exigir a reinicialização. Um forte sinal de falha no disco rígido é uma falha no computador quando você está tentando acessar arquivos.
Qual é o motivo mais comum para um pod de denunciar o CrashLoopbackoff como seu estado?
CrashLoopbackoff é uma mensagem de status que indica que uma de suas vagens está em constante estado de fluxo - um ou mais recipientes está falhando e reiniciando repetidamente. Isso normalmente acontece porque cada vagem herda um reiniciado padrão de sempre na criação.
Qual é o motivo da falha do pod?
No entanto, existem várias razões para a falha do pod, alguns deles são os seguintes: imagem errada usada para pod. Comando/argumentos errados são passados para a vagem. Kubelet não conseguiu verificar a vivacidade do pod (i.e., A sonda de vivacidade falhou).
Como faço para impedir que um recipiente do documento seja reiniciado?
Você pode usar a opção--restart =, a menos que paro, como @shibashis mencionado, ou atualizar a política de reinicialização (isso requer Docker 1.11 ou mais recente); Veja a documentação para atualização do Docker e políticas de reinicialização do Docker. Use o Docker Update - -renderTrt = NÃO (Docker PS -A -Q) para atualizar todos os seus contêineres :-) Ótima resposta!!
Reiniciando um contêiner perde dados?
Se o contêiner ainda existir e parado "pode ser visto por Docker PS -A", você pode reiniciá -lo sem perder os dados do contêiner. Além disso, se você estiver montando o diretório de dados do contêiner para um diretório na máquina host, você ainda terá os dados, mesmo que o contêiner seja removido.
O que é reversão na AWS?
Os gatilhos de reversão permitem que você tenha a AWS CloudFormation monitore o estado do seu aplicativo durante a criação e atualização da pilha e reverte essa operação se o aplicativo violar o limiar de qualquer um dos alarmes que você especificou. Para mais informações, consulte operações de pilha de monitor e reversão.
O que reinicia um contêiner faz?
Exemplo de contêiner de reinicialização do Docker simples
Este comando executará o contêiner do Docker e sairá após 10 segundos. Aqui podemos ver que o contêiner está em um estado de saída e permanecerá parado até que alguém o reinicie. Reiniciar o contêiner do docker ajuda a alterar o estado do contêiner de sair para o estado de corrida.
Como faço para impedir que um recipiente do documento seja reiniciado?
Você pode usar a opção--restart =, a menos que paro, como @shibashis mencionado, ou atualizar a política de reinicialização (isso requer Docker 1.11 ou mais recente); Veja a documentação para atualização do Docker e políticas de reinicialização do Docker. Use o Docker Update - -renderTrt = NÃO (Docker PS -A -Q) para atualizar todos os seus contêineres :-) Ótima resposta!!
Como faço para mudar a política de reinicialização do contêiner?
Reinicie os detalhes da política
Uma política de reinicialização só entra em vigor depois que um contêiner inicia com sucesso. Nesse caso, iniciar com sucesso significa que o contêiner está em torno de pelo menos 10 segundos e o Docker começou a monitorá -lo. Isso impede um recipiente que não começa a entrar em um loop de reinicialização.
Como alterar a política de reinicialização do contêiner do Docker?
Houve duas abordagens para modificar o reiniciar: descubra o ID do contêiner, pare todo. JSON, SET RESTARTPOLICY -> Nome para "sempre" e iniciar o serviço do Docker.
O que é a política de reinicialização do contêiner sobre o fracasso?
OnFailure significa que o contêiner só será reiniciado se tivesse saído de um código de saída diferente de zero (i.e. algo deu errado). Isso é útil quando você deseja realizar uma certa tarefa com o pod e verifique se ela completa com êxito - se não for, será reiniciado até que.
Reiniciando o Docker reiniciar todos os recipientes?
não, não reinicie automaticamente o contêiner. (o padrão) Reiniciar o contêiner, se ele sair devido a um erro, que se manifesta como um código de saída diferente de zero. sempre sempre reinicie o recipiente se ele parar.